summ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O7
-rw-r--r--PKGBUILD6
-rw-r--r--kalu.install13
3 files changed, 21 insertions, 5 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 78945dd62fee..4b74cf31cb43 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,8 +1,9 @@
pkgbase = kalu
pkgdesc = Upgrade notifier w/ AUR support, watched (AUR) packages, news
- pkgver = 2.1.0
+ pkgver = 2.2.0
pkgrel = 1
url = http://jjacky.com/kalu
+ install = kalu.install
arch = i686
arch = x86_64
license = GPL3+
@@ -16,8 +17,8 @@ pkgbase = kalu
depends = curl
depends = libnotify
depends = notification-daemon
- source = http://jjacky.com/kalu/kalu-2.1.0.tar.gz
- md5sums = 2282b38b26749834375059423da1bb17
+ source = http://jjacky.com/kalu/kalu-2.2.0.tar.gz
+ md5sums = fb321c5681dcab5500defa4dd2f7d93b
pkgname = kalu
diff --git a/PKGBUILD b/PKGBUILD
index 377b16ca2128..023aa5c278a1 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,6 +1,6 @@
# Maintainer: jjacky
pkgname=kalu
-pkgver=2.1.0
+pkgver=2.2.0
pkgrel=1
pkgdesc="Upgrade notifier w/ AUR support, watched (AUR) packages, news"
arch=('i686' 'x86_64')
@@ -10,7 +10,8 @@ depends=('dbus' 'polkit' 'gtk3' 'pacman>=4.1.1' 'pacman<4.2' 'curl' 'libnotify'
'notification-daemon')
makedepends=('perl' 'groff')
source=(http://jjacky.com/$pkgname/$pkgname-$pkgver.tar.gz)
-md5sums=('2282b38b26749834375059423da1bb17')
+install=kalu.install
+md5sums=('fb321c5681dcab5500defa4dd2f7d93b')
build() {
cd "$srcdir/$pkgname-$pkgver"
@@ -21,6 +22,7 @@ build() {
package() {
cd "$srcdir/$pkgname-$pkgver"
make DESTDIR="$pkgdir/" install
+ chmod 700 "$pkgdir/usr/share/polkit-1/rules.d"
}
# vim:set ts=2 sw=2 et:
diff --git a/kalu.install b/kalu.install
new file mode 100644
index 000000000000..ca7149a8b595
--- /dev/null
+++ b/kalu.install
@@ -0,0 +1,13 @@
+post_install() {
+ /usr/bin/getent group kalu >/dev/null 2>&1 || usr/sbin/groupadd -g 214 kalu &>/dev/null
+}
+
+post_upgrade() {
+ post_install
+}
+
+post_remove() {
+ if /usr/bin/getent group kalu >/dev/null 2>&1; then
+ /usr/sbin/groupdel kalu
+ fi
+}